Output 947624955058ffa10335a6c26bff5e6e94497e1212d724816bcef45cea6846f7:5

value
100214
script pubkey
OP_HASH160 OP_PUSHBYTES_20 15c357ad2d3c51c0a884590a9637f84185f73d68 OP_EQUAL
address
33g68CuWBjrFikv1eifTRqEwJuJhw8eMBt
transaction
947624955058ffa10335a6c26bff5e6e94497e1212d724816bcef45cea6846f7
spent
true